How to Choose the Right Best Hair Trap for Bathtub
Size and capacity
Choosing the right size and capacity for a bathtub hair trap means matching it precisely to your drain diameter while considering how much hair accumulation it can handle. Good traps fit snugly over or inside drains typically ranging from one and a half to two inches in diameter. Capacity matters when multiple users share a tub or heavy shedding occurs; the trap should hold enough strands to avoid frequent removal.
Compact designs that hug the drain surface without protruding offer the best blend of visibility and minimal interference with water flow. Opt for a medium-sized mesh trap or silicone cup that accommodates standard drains and collects ample hair for routine household use.
Material durability and safety
Material choice is crucial for durability and hygiene in a hair trap. Select traps made from sturdy silicone or rust-resistant stainless steel, as these resist cracking, tears, and corrosion over months of contact with water and shampoo. The material must also inhibit mold growth and remain safe without releasing harmful chemicals; silicone fits this standard well.
A flexible material allows easy placement and removal without damage to the trap or drain, whereas a rigid build offers better shape retention and snag prevention. For most users, a flexible, non-toxic silicone model balances longevity and safety seamlessly.
Design and installation
A hair trap should be straightforward to install without tools or expert assistance and fit a variety of bathtub setups. Look for designs that slide easily over the drain or nest within it, accommodating edge variations and tap configurations. Reliable nonslip features like suction cups or textured grips on the trap’s underside keep it firmly anchored during use, preventing it from shifting or floating away.
A universally compatible trap with multiple attachment points works best across different tub styles while offering quick, hassle-free installation to avoid any plumbing modifications.
Cleaning and maintenance
Maintenance is simplified by traps that release caught hair easily and resist buildup over time. Choose designs with smooth, non-porous surfaces that rinse clean quickly and do not trap soap scum or residue. Removable meshes or silicone cups that detach effortlessly facilitate hair disposal, reducing the risk of clogging.
Models explicitly marked as dishwasher safe further streamline deep cleaning, saving effort. Prioritize traps with open patterns allowing water to run freely while capturing debris, ensuring minimal maintenance and prolonging service life.
Additional features and value
Look for hair traps incorporating antibacterial or odor-neutralizing properties to maintain freshness and prevent mildew, especially in humid bathrooms. Reusability is key—select a trap that cleans thoroughly and retains form after repeated cycles rather than disposable ones. Sustainability-minded buyers benefit from durable materials that reduce waste and offer extended use.
Consider products offering solid warranty coverage for peace of mind and ensure the trap delivers reliable performance relative to its build quality, making it a smart investment for keeping drains hair-free over time.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Material Is Best For A Bathtub Hair Trap?
Silicone is often the best material for a bathtub hair trap because it is flexible, durable, and resistant to mold buildup. Its pliability allows it to conform to different drain shapes, making it highly effective at catching hair without causing clogs.
How Do I Install A Bathtub Hair Trap Effectively?
Installing a bathtub hair trap is straightforward since most models are designed for tool-free placement. Simply align the trap with the drain and press it firmly into place, ensuring a secure fit that catches hair while allowing water to drain freely.
Can A Hair Trap Prevent All Bathtub Clogs?
While a high-quality hair trap captures the majority of hair and debris, it may not prevent all clogs entirely. Regular maintenance and cleaning of the trap are essential to maintain its effectiveness and avoid buildup that can cause blockage.
How Often Should I Clean My Bathtub Hair Trap?
Cleaning a bathtub hair trap weekly is recommended to maintain optimal performance. Removing trapped hair and rinsing the trap prevents clog formation and odor, ensuring the drain remains clear and sanitary.
Are Reusable Hair Traps More Cost-Effective?
Yes, reusable hair traps offer better cost-effectiveness because they reduce the need for frequent replacements. Made from durable materials, they can be cleaned and reused multiple times, making them an eco-friendly and economical choice.
